Understanding Cryptocurrency Fees: Market Trends and Dynamics
The landscape of cryptocurrency fees is constantly evolving, driven by technological advancements, network adoption, and market demand. Historically, early blockchains like Bitcoin and Ethereum experienced significant fee fluctuations, particularly during periods of high network congestion. Bitcoin's fees are primarily determined by transaction size and network demand, while Ethereum's gas fees are influenced by computational complexity and a bidding mechanism for block space. The introduction of EIP-1559 on Ethereum aimed to make fee estimation more predictable by incorporating a base fee and a tip, but volatility can still occur.
A major trend in the market is the development and increasing adoption of Layer 2 scaling solutions. These protocols, built on top of existing blockchains (e.g., rollups for Ethereum), process transactions off the main chain and then batch them for settlement, significantly reducing per-transaction costs. This has led to a competitive environment where various Layer 2s vie for users by offering lower fees and faster transaction times. Similarly, newer Layer 1 blockchains are often designed with scalability in mind, employing different consensus mechanisms or sharding architectures to achieve higher throughput and consequently lower fees.
Another trend is the differentiation in fee models across various exchanges and platforms. Some centralized exchanges have moved towards a 'maker-taker' fee model, where liquidity providers (makers) pay lower fees or even receive rebates, while liquidity removers (takers) pay a standard fee. Decentralized exchanges (DEXs) often have liquidity provider fees and network transaction fees, which can vary based on the underlying blockchain and the specific DEX protocol.
Regulatory Landscape and Its Impact on Fees
The global regulatory landscape for cryptocurrencies is still developing, but its influence on fees is becoming more apparent. Regulatory bodies like the U.S. Securities and Exchange Commission (SEC), the Financial Conduct Authority (FCA) in the UK, and the European Union's Markets in Crypto-Assets (MiCA) regulation are working to establish frameworks for digital assets. Increased regulatory scrutiny often leads to enhanced compliance requirements for exchanges and service providers. These compliance costs, such as those related to Know Your Customer (KYC) and Anti-Money Laundering (AML) procedures, can sometimes be passed on to users in the form of higher operational fees or tighter spreads.
Conversely, clearer regulations can foster greater institutional adoption and innovation, potentially leading to more efficient markets and lower fees in the long run. For example, regulatory clarity around stablecoins could lead to their wider use in payments, where their low-cost, fast settlement characteristics are highly beneficial compared to traditional financial rails. However, the exact impact of future regulations on specific fee structures remains an area of ongoing observation.
Emerging Features and Practical Advice
Emerging features are continually shaping the low-fee crypto environment. Account abstraction, for instance, aims to allow users to pay transaction fees with any token, not just the native network token, and could enable sponsored transactions where a third party covers the fees. This could significantly enhance user experience and reduce the perceived cost of interacting with blockchains.
Cross-chain interoperability protocols are also advancing, aiming to reduce the friction and cost of moving assets between different blockchains. As these technologies mature, users can expect more seamless and cost-effective multi-chain strategies.
For practical advice, always compare fees across multiple platforms before executing a transaction, especially for withdrawals and swaps. Utilize tools that track real-time network gas fees for networks like Ethereum to identify optimal times for transactions. Consider using stablecoins for value transfer if volatility is a concern, as their transaction fees are typically lower than those for more volatile assets if the underlying network is efficient. Finally, continuously educate yourself on the latest scaling solutions and platform updates, as the most cost-effective methods can change frequently.

Pricing and Fees: A Detailed Breakdown
When comparing cryptocurrencies and platforms based on fees, a granular approach is essential. It's not enough to look at a single advertised transaction fee. We analyze several categories of fees:
- Trading Fees: These are typically charged on spot trades, futures, and other derivatives. They often follow a maker-taker model, where liquidity providers (makers) pay less or receive rebates, and liquidity takers pay a percentage of the trade value. We assess the competitiveness of these percentages across various trading volumes.
- Deposit Fees: While many platforms offer free deposits for cryptocurrencies, some may charge for fiat deposits via bank transfers, credit cards, or other payment methods. We verify these costs.
- Withdrawal Fees: This is a critical area, as withdrawal fees can vary significantly and are often fixed amounts regardless of the withdrawal size. These fees cover the network transaction cost and a small service charge from the platform. We compare these fixed fees for common cryptocurrencies across different platforms.
- Network Fees (Gas Fees): For blockchains like Ethereum, Solana, or Polygon, transaction costs are determined by network congestion and the computational complexity of the operation. We assess how platforms display and manage these fees, and if they offer options to select different fee priorities.
- Spread Costs: On platforms that advertise 'zero-fee' trading, costs are often embedded in the bid-ask spread. We compare the effective spread against market benchmarks to identify hidden costs.
- Other Fees: This includes fees for staking, lending, borrowing, margin funding, and inactivity fees. Each has to be considered depending on user activity.
We specifically look for platforms that offer transparency in their fee structures, providing clear breakdowns and avoiding opaque pricing models.

5-7 Actionable Expert Tips for Cost-Effective Crypto Use
- Understand Network Congestion: Fees on many popular blockchains, especially Ethereum, fluctuate significantly with network traffic. Learn to monitor gas trackers and execute transactions during off-peak hours (often weekends or late at night in major time zones) to save substantially on gas fees.
- Utilize Layer 2 Solutions: For Ethereum-based assets, prioritize using Layer 2 networks like Arbitrum, Optimism, zkSync, or Base. These offer drastically lower transaction costs and faster speeds by processing transactions off the main chain. Ensure your chosen platform supports direct deposits and withdrawals to these Layer 2s.
- Compare Withdrawal Fees Extensively: Withdrawal fees from exchanges to external wallets can be a major hidden cost. Always compare these fees across multiple exchanges before making a deposit, as they can vary widely for the same cryptocurrency. Some exchanges might offer free withdrawals for certain assets or networks.
- Consider Stablecoins for Transfers: If your primary goal is to transfer value with minimal fees and without exposure to volatility, stablecoins on efficient networks (e.g., USDT/USDC on Tron, Polygon, or BSC) often provide a cost-effective solution compared to transferring volatile assets like Bitcoin or Ethereum directly.
- Review the Full Fee Schedule: Do not just look at trading fees. Dig into the platform's complete fee schedule, including deposit, withdrawal, staking, and potential inactivity fees. A platform with seemingly low trading fees might have high withdrawal costs that negate any savings.
- Beware of Wide Spreads on 'Zero-Fee' Platforms: Platforms advertising 'zero-fee trading' often embed their costs in the bid-ask spread. Always compare the buy/sell price offered by such platforms against a reliable market index to ensure you are getting a fair price. A wide spread can effectively be a hidden fee.

Common Mistakes to Avoid
- Ignoring Network Fees: A common mistake is focusing only on exchange trading fees and forgetting the underlying blockchain network fees, especially when moving assets off the exchange. These can be significant.
- Not Verifying Addresses: Always double-check recipient addresses, especially when dealing with different networks (e.g., sending ETH to an ERC-20 address vs. a BNB Smart Chain address). Incorrect transfers can result in permanent loss of funds, making any fee savings irrelevant.
- Over-trading on High-Fee Chains: Frequent, small transactions on high-fee networks can quickly erode capital. Plan your transactions to minimize the number of interactions with expensive chains.
- Falling for Unrealistic Promises: Be skeptical of platforms promising extremely low or non-existent fees without a clear, sustainable business model. If it sounds too good to be true, it often is.
- Neglecting Security for Cost: Never compromise on security for the sake of lower fees. A platform with robust security measures, even if slightly more expensive, offers better long-term protection for your assets.

Frequently Asked Questions
Which crypto exchange has the lowest fees?
Binance has the lowest fees overall at 0.10% maker/taker (dropping to 0.075% with BNB). Kraken Pro is the best low-fee US option at 0.16%/0.26%. Always use the Pro or Advanced interface.
How do crypto exchange fees work?
Most exchanges charge maker/taker fees as a percentage of each trade. Makers add liquidity (limit orders) and pay less. Takers remove liquidity (market orders) and pay more.
Are there hidden fees on crypto exchanges?
Yes. Watch for spread markups on simple buy interfaces (1-2%), withdrawal fees, and deposit fees for credit/debit cards (3-5%). Always use the advanced trading interface.
